What are the key factors that shareholders consider when voting on cryptocurrency investments?

When it comes to voting on cryptocurrency investments, what are the main factors that shareholders take into consideration?

3 answers
- Shareholders consider several key factors when voting on cryptocurrency investments. Firstly, they assess the project's team and their expertise in the crypto industry. A strong team with a proven track record increases the likelihood of success. Additionally, shareholders analyze the project's whitepaper and roadmap to evaluate its potential for growth and innovation. They also consider the project's market traction, partnerships, and community engagement as indicators of its potential success. Finally, shareholders assess the project's tokenomics, including its token distribution, utility, and potential for value appreciation. These factors help shareholders make informed decisions when voting on cryptocurrency investments.
